A Pennsylvania Value Added Reseller (VAR) Support Agreement is a formal contract that outlines the terms and conditions between a supplier or manufacturer and a value added reseller operating in the state of Pennsylvania. In this agreement, the supplier provides support and resources to the VAR to assist them in selling and supporting the supplier's products or services. The Pennsylvania VAR Support Agreement typically includes various key provisions, such as: 1. Scope of Agreement: This section defines the products or services covered under the agreement and outlines the specific responsibilities of both the supplier and VAR. 2. Support and Training: The agreement details the type and level of support the supplier will provide to the VAR, including technical assistance, training programs, and access to documentation and resources. 3. Pricing and Discounts: It specifies the pricing structure, discounts, and any special incentives offered to the VAR to promote the supplier's products or services effectively. 4. Marketing and Promotion: This section outlines the marketing activities and strategies that the VAR is expected to undertake to generate sales and promote the supplier's products or services within Pennsylvania. 5. Territory: The agreement may define the geographic territory or market in which the VAR is authorized to sell the supplier's products or services. It may also address exclusivity or non-compete provisions within that territory. 6. Performance Expectations: The agreement often includes performance metrics, such as sales targets, customer satisfaction goals, and specific deliverables the VAR is expected to achieve. 7. Reporting and Communication: It outlines the reporting requirements, such as periodic sales reports, inventory updates, and communication channels between the supplier and VAR. 8. Intellectual Property: This provision addresses the ownership and usage rights of any intellectual property related to the supplier's products or brands and protects both parties' interests. Different types of Pennsylvania VAR Support Agreements may exist based on the industry or specific products/services involved. For instance: 1. Technology VAR Support Agreement: This type of agreement is common in the technology sector, where Vars sell hardware, software, or IT solutions to businesses in Pennsylvania. The agreement may cover support for installation, configuration, troubleshooting, and ongoing technical assistance. 2. Medical Equipment VAR Support Agreement: In the healthcare industry, medical equipment Vars work closely with manufacturers, offering support for the sale, installation, and maintenance of medical devices or equipment. The VAR Support Agreement here would encompass comprehensive technical training and well-defined service level agreements. 3. Industrial Supplies VAR Support Agreement: Vars in the industrial supply sector often partner with manufacturers to distribute products like machinery, tools, or components. The agreement focuses on pricing, inventory management, logistics, and marketing support to drive sales in Pennsylvania.
